USGS: 2.7 M earthquake near Tuttle
Sep. 27—Tuttle residents may have felt a rumble on Tuesday afternoon.
The U.S. Geological Survey (USGS) reported at 2.7 magnitude earthquake four miles from Tuttle at 12:05 p.m. on Sept. 27.
The earthquake had a depth of 6.5 km, according to USGS.
